"Rundll32.exe is used by Windows to launch actions defined in DLLs. One of its capabilities is running Control Panel tools (applets)."

It can also launch other Windows tasks such as shutdowns, mouse button swaps, keyboard/mouse activation/deactivation, start Explorer, etc.